Cheremshanka (tributary of Yemets)

Cheremshanka - a river in Russia , flows in the Tyumen region. The mouth of the river is 24 km on the right bank of the Emets River. The river is 15 km long [2] .

Water system: Yemets → Vagay → Irtysh → Ob → Kara Sea .

Water registry data

According to the Russian State Water Register, it belongs to the Irtysh basin district , the Irtysh water sector from the confluence of the Ishim River to the confluence of the Tobol River, the river sub-basin - the Irtysh tributaries from Ishim to Tobol. The river basin of the river is the Irtysh [2] .

The object code in the state water registry is 14010400112115300012618 [2] .
